Transaction 7e0fec3b93b4e96910652666eeecf2dbfecb73e400d9d17be74bd8ccd24a2623
1 Input
2 Outputs
- 7e0fec3b93b4e96910652666eeecf2dbfecb73e400d9d17be74bd8ccd24a2623:0
- 7e0fec3b93b4e96910652666eeecf2dbfecb73e400d9d17be74bd8ccd24a2623:1
value 111150
address 3BMEXuY73GDZKrqwhnDCUV2wiv7whEsAaY
value 84632433
address 32WSk67w8Pc1ha2vH9gCcRjfQytDeXDpNa